Goldbach decomposition
Goldbach's conjecture says every even integer greater than 2 is the sum of two primes. For 29776, here are decompositions:
- 17 + 29759 = 29776
- 23 + 29753 = 29776
- 53 + 29723 = 29776
- 59 + 29717 = 29776
- 107 + 29669 = 29776
- 113 + 29663 = 29776
- 239 + 29537 = 29776
- 293 + 29483 = 29776
Showing the first eight; more decompositions exist.
